Klas-Kennys LED-blinkare
Postat: 28 augusti 2016, 13:39:47
Litet lagom förmiddagsprojekt, bidrar också till den pågående "tävlingen" om lysdiodsblinkare.
Här så slår jag ett litet slag för oss som gärna vänder sig till µC före diskreta lösningar.
En liten PIC 12F1501 med 100nF avkopplingskondensator, ett 180 ohms motstånd och en röd lysdiod, är allt som behövdes här. Schema torde knappast vara nödvändigt.
Dessutom, för att stega upp det hela lite, så driver jag det ifrån en knappcell. 2032 av ytterst tveksam kvalité. Mäter i alla fall ~3V idag.
Tyvärr hade jag ingen LF-variant av µC'n. Denna klarar sig bara ner till 2,3V, LF hade klarat sig till 1,8. Men men.
Har dock ändrat tiderna lite mot de andra. Ett kort blink med en på-tid av ungefär 10ms. Klart tillräckligt för att se, utan att dra onödigt mycket ström. Dessutom blinkar jag bara en gång var fjärde sekund ungefär.
Klockar µC'n med 31kHz intern oscillator, och såklart ligger den i sleep hela tiden och vaknar bara för att tända eller släcka lysdioden.
Mätte strömförbrukningen lite snabbt, mest för att se att den verkligen gick i sleep. Drar några µA med lysdioden släckt, och strax över 5mA med lysdioden tänd. Så, såklart gör det stor skillnad att dra ner duty cykle ordentligt.
Bilder: Körde sen krympslang runt hela. Får väl se hur länge den blinkar.
Edit 170224: fyra sekunder mellan blink, inte två..
Här så slår jag ett litet slag för oss som gärna vänder sig till µC före diskreta lösningar.
En liten PIC 12F1501 med 100nF avkopplingskondensator, ett 180 ohms motstånd och en röd lysdiod, är allt som behövdes här. Schema torde knappast vara nödvändigt.
Dessutom, för att stega upp det hela lite, så driver jag det ifrån en knappcell. 2032 av ytterst tveksam kvalité. Mäter i alla fall ~3V idag.
Tyvärr hade jag ingen LF-variant av µC'n. Denna klarar sig bara ner till 2,3V, LF hade klarat sig till 1,8. Men men.
Har dock ändrat tiderna lite mot de andra. Ett kort blink med en på-tid av ungefär 10ms. Klart tillräckligt för att se, utan att dra onödigt mycket ström. Dessutom blinkar jag bara en gång var fjärde sekund ungefär.
Klockar µC'n med 31kHz intern oscillator, och såklart ligger den i sleep hela tiden och vaknar bara för att tända eller släcka lysdioden.
Mätte strömförbrukningen lite snabbt, mest för att se att den verkligen gick i sleep. Drar några µA med lysdioden släckt, och strax över 5mA med lysdioden tänd. Så, såklart gör det stor skillnad att dra ner duty cykle ordentligt.
Bilder: Körde sen krympslang runt hela. Får väl se hur länge den blinkar.
Edit 170224: fyra sekunder mellan blink, inte två..